Grading

The course is graded out of 100 points:

  • 85p Project (groups of 4–5 students)
    • 15p Project Part 1
    • 5p peer grading for Project Part 1
    • 15p Project Part 2
    • 5p peer grading for Project Part 2
    • 15p Project Part 3
    • 5p peer grading for Project Part 3
    • 25p final poster session
  • 15p Lecture quizzes
    • 6 quizzes, 2.5p each

There is no final exam.

The quizzes are associated with the pre-recorded lectures. Each quiz must be completed after the lecture and before the corresponding practice session.

To pass the course, you need at least 51 points in total.

Passing grades:

  • A 91-100p
  • B 81-90p
  • C 71-80p
  • D 61-70p
  • E 51-60p
  • F 0-50p

Projects

The project should demonstrate the development of an end-to-end data engineering product.

Projects are completed in fixed groups of 4–5 students and consist of three parts:

  • Part 1: Dataset selection and project proposal design
  • Part 2: Conceptual model and data architecture
  • Part 3: Project Finalization and Presentation

The three parts are incremental: together, they should describe and implement a coherent data engineering product rather than three independent assignments.

Each project part is worth 15 points. In addition, each part includes a 5-point peer-grading component.

Poster Session

The final project assessment takes the form of a poster session on 18 January 2027 at 16:15.

Participation in the poster session is physical and mandatory.

Each group must prepare a poster presenting the complete project, including the problem and dataset, data model and architecture, implementation, and final results.

During the poster session, groups will present their work and discuss it with the teaching staff.

The poster session is worth 25 points.

Examples of posters, the required poster format, and detailed evaluation criteria will be provided on Moodle.
